Simplicity, Control, and Range

Lincoln Electric has designed this machine around three core principles: Simplicity, Control, and Range. Simplicity is achieved through features like AC Auto Balance®, which automatically sets the perfect mix of cleaning and penetration for aluminum welding, letting you focus on the puddle rather than the settings. Control is placed firmly in your hands with the Advanced Pulse Control panel. By activating the TIG pulser, you can minimize warping on thin sheet metal and achieve that stack-of-dimes look with ease. Range is delivered through the massive 420-amp top end and the incredibly stable low-end start, powered by Micro-Start™ II Technology.

FAQ

The K2622-1 model operates on single-phase power with selectable input voltages of 208V, 230V, or 460V at 60Hz.

Yes, the Precision TIG 375 is an AC/DC machine equipped with AC Auto Balance®, making it excellent for welding aluminum.

The machine offers the widest operating range in its class, from as low as 2 Amps up to a maximum of 420 Amps.

The K2622-1 base model typically includes the machine, torch hanger, and storage compartment. TIG torches, foot pedals, and other accessories are often sold separately or in 'Ready-Pak' bundles. Please check the specific package contents.

Micro-Start™ II is a patented technology by Lincoln Electric that enhances low-amperage starting, arc stability, and crater fill control, ensuring precise welds even on thin materials.

Yes, the Precision TIG 375 has excellent Stick welding capabilities and can handle up to 3/16" (4.8mm) electrodes, including cellulosic rods like Fleetweld 5P+.

The TIG pulser helps control heat input into the weld, which minimizes distortion and warping on thin materials and helps moderate filler metal deposition for better bead appearance.

The machine weighs approximately 507 lbs (230 kg). It is recommended to use a compatible undercarriage or cart for mobility.
